I wrote a small program that reads some bytes of data coming from a radio receiver module. I do not want that the receiver program gets stuck in case the transmitter goes off for some reason. The receiver program is this :
SERIN PORTB.0,N1200,["COUNT"],W
SERIN PORTB.0,N1200,["ST0"],S_T.BYTE0
SERIN PORTB.0,N1200,["ST1"],S_T.BYTE1
SERIN PORTB.0,N1200,["SRH0"],S_RH.BYTE0
SERIN PORTB.0,N1200,["SRH1"],S_RH.BYTE1
SERIN PORTB.0,N1200,["WIND"],WND
SERIN PORTB.0,N1200,["IRR0"],IRR.BYTE0
SERIN PORTB.0,N1200,["IRR1"],IRR.BYTE1
SERIN PORTB.0,N1200,["VBAT0"],V_BATT.BYTE0
SERIN PORTB.0,N1200,["VBAT1"],V_BATT.BYTE1
If the transmitter goes off then the receiver locks up waiting for the "STRING". How could I overcome this problem ?
